You may want to E-mail SOE with the measurements for your M2 pouches.

To me,it looks like you may have received a pouch for a pistol mag by mistake.

The SOE M2 and M3 pouches I have fit both flashlights with room to spare. In fact I have used them with both click switches ( S48 and SW-02) installed on the flashlight.
